Winter Games New Zealand: Freeski Halfpipe

From the World of Freesports: “Competitors brought their A-game to the finals of the FIS Australia New Zealand Cup Freeski & Snowboard Halfpipe presented by Cardrona Alpine Resort at the QRC Winter Games NZ, fuelled by Forsyth Barr today. The judges had their work cut out for them all day long with competitors pushing their limits to earn their spot on the podium. Halfpipe judging criteria is based on trick variety, difficulty, and execution as well as the amplitude a competitor can gain above the wall of the 22ft high pipe. The skiers were the first to drop into superpipe with the 10 men and eight women each taking three runs and their top score deciding the final results.”

RESULTS: Winter Games New Zealand Freeski Halfpipe

WOMEN’S FREESKI HALFPIPE
First: Eileen Gu, CHN. 88
Second: Valeriya Demindova, RUS. 86.66
Third: Zoe Atkin, GBR. 76.33

MEN’S FREESKI HALFPIPE
First: Bingqiang Mao, CHN. 87.66
Second: Cassidy Jarrell, USA. 85.33
Third: Jaxin Hoerter, USA. 83.33
